Description

This 1930s built detached bungalow has undergone complete refurbishment and has been extended to the rear and side elevations to a high specification indeed. There are many features for the discerning purchaser to consider, which are listed within the main brochure. The accommodation affords four bedrooms, a desirable social living space of 8.34m x 5.61m, comprising a fully integrated kitchen, family and dining space, a separate utility room, stylish en-suite shower room off the main bedroom, contemporary family bathroom and cloakroom off the deep hallway (9m deep). Outside you will find a paved patio, garden area laid to lawn, side access and block-paved frontage for parking several cars. To fully appreciate the overall space on offer and attention to detail applied by the present owner, interior viewing comes highly recommended. Exclusive to PROCTORS. For the growing family or buyers looking for everything on one level, but not willing to compromise on space this property is for you. Pinewood Drive is ideally placed for reputable schools, grammar schools St Olaves and Newstead Woods, good transport links, Orpington mainline station, The Crescent for handy shops, Orpington and Green St Green amenities.
